From Blue Lake to Cutten by bus
To get from Blue Lake to Cutten in Humboldt County, you’ll need to take 3 bus lines: take the NSE299 bus from Greenwood Ave (Blue Lake City Hall) station to Arcata Transit Center station. Next, you’ll have to switch to the RTS bus and finally take the E RNBW bus from 3rd St & V St station to Harrison St & Harris St station. The total trip duration for this route is approximately 3 hr 9 min. The ride fare is $6.00.
